Abstract
UNLABELLED We undertook cluster analysis in 11,003 patients who had sustained ≥ 1 fragility fracture, to find associations between fracture sites and comorbidities. We identified three distinct groups of fracture sites and four clusters of fractures and comorbidities. Knowledge of factors associated with fracture sites will aid prophylaxis in at-risk patients. INTRODUCTION Fragility fracture (FF) prevalence is increasing. Subsequent fractures lead to greater morbidity and mortality. Few data are available on the association between FF sites and comorbidities. OBJECTIVES 1. Establish the most common sites of FF and clusters within patients. 2. Identify patterns of co-existing FF and associated comorbidities. METHODS We retrospectively reviewed clinical records of patients undergoing bone mineral density estimation at a district hospital in North-West England, 2004-2016, identifying those who had sustained ≥ 1 FF. Demographics, FF site(s), comorbidities, and medications were recorded. Cluster analysis was performed on fracture sites alone, and sites and comorbidities, using Jaccard similarity coefficient. Results were plotted on a dendrogram and divided into clusters. RESULTS Of 28,868 patients, 11,003 had sustained ≥ 1 FF, 84.6% female, with overall mean age 67.5 years and median T-score - 1.12 SD. FF of the forearm was more frequent (n = 5045), most commonly co-existing with tibia/fibula fractures. Three FF site clusters were identified: ankle and elbow; forearm, tibia/fibula, ribs and spine; and pelvis, femur and humerus. When including comorbidities, four clusters were identified: forearm, tibia/fibula, spine, associated with family history of FF, smoking, corticosteroids and bisphosphonates; pelvis associated with hyperparathyroidism, PMR, coeliac disease and HRT; femur and humerus associated with IBD and RA; and ribs associated with alcohol and hyperthyroidism. CONCLUSION Cluster analysis demonstrated three fracture site clusters, and four subgroups of FF sites and comorbidities. Cluster analysis is a novel method to evaluate comorbidities associated with FF sites. Knowledge of factors associated with FF sites will aid prophylaxis in at-risk patients.

Abstract
BackgroundOpportunistic and chronic infections can arise in the context of treatment used for Autoimmune Rheumatic Diseases (ARDs). Although it is recognized that screening procedures and prophylactic measures must be followed, clinical practice is largely heterogeneous, with relevant recommendations not currently developed or disparately located across the literature.ObjectivesTo conduct a systematic literature review (SLR) focusing on the screening and prophylaxis of opportunistic and chronic infections in ARDs. This is preparatory work done by members of the respective EULAR task force (TF).MethodsFollowing the EULAR standardised operating procedures, we conducted an SLR with the following 5 search domains; 1) Infection: infectious agents identifed by a scoping review and expert opinion (TF members), 2) Rheumatic Diseases: all ARDs, 3) Immunosuppression: all immunosuppressives/immunomodulators used in rheumatology, 4) Screening: general and specific (e.g mantoux test) terms, 5) Prophylaxis: general and specific (e.g trimethoprim) terms. Articles were retrieved having the terms from domains 1 AND 2 AND 3, plus terms from domains 4 OR 5. Databases searched: Pubmed, Embase, Cochrane. Exclusion criteria: post-operative infections, pediatric ARDs, not ARDs (e.g septic arthritis), not concerning screening or prophylaxis, Covid-19 studies, articles concerning vaccinations and non-Εnglish literature. Quality of studies included was assessed as follows: Newcastle Ottawa scale for non-randomized controlled trials (RCTs), RoB-Cochrane tool for RCTs, AMSTAR2 for SLRs.Results5641 studies were initially retrieved (Figure 1). After title and abstract screening and removal of duplicates, 568 full-text articles were assessed for eligibility. Finally, 293 articles were included in the SLR. Most studies were of medium quality. Reasons for exclusion are shown in Figure 1. Results categorized as per type of microbe, are as follows: For Tuberculosis; evidence suggests that tuberculin skin test (TST) is affected by treatment with glucocorticoids and conventional synthetic DMARDs (csDMARDs) and its performance is inferior to interferon gamma release assay (IGRA). Agreement between TST and IGRA is moderate to low. Conversion of TST/IGRA occurs in about 10-15% of patients treated with biologic DMARDs (bDMARDs). Various prophylactic schemes have been used for latent TB, including isoniazide for 9 months, rifampicin for 4 months, isoniazide/rifampicin for 3-4 months. For hepatitis B (HBV): there is evidence that risk of reactivation is increased in patients positive for hepatitis B surface antigen. These patients should be referred for HBV treatment. Patients who are positive for anti-HBcore antibodies, are at low risk for reactivation when treated with glucocorticoids, cDMARDs and bDMARDs but should be monitored periodically with liver function tests and HBV-viral load. Patients treated with rituximab display higher risk for HBV reactivation especially when anti-HBs titers are low. Risk for reactivation in hepatitis C RNA positive patients, treated with bDMARDs is low. However, all patients should be referred for antiviral treatment and monitored periodically. For pneumocystis jirovecii: prophylaxis with trimethoprim/sulfamethoxazole (alternatively with atovaquone or pentamidine) should be considered in patients treated with prednisolone: 15-30mg/day for more than 4 weeks. Few data exist for screening and prophylaxis from viruses like EBV, CMV and Varicella Zoster Virus. Expert opinion supports the screening of rare bugs like histoplasma and trypanosoma in patients considered to be at high risk (e.g living in endemic areas).Figure 1.SLR flowchartConclusionThe risk of chronic and opportunistic infections should be considered in all patients prior to treatment with immunosuppressives/immunomodulators. Different screening and prophylaxis approaches are described in the literature, partly determined by individual patient and disease characteristics. Abstract
BackgroundGiant cell arteritis-related stroke is rare, with high early mortality and major morbidity in survivors.ObjectivesTo increase the awareness of coexistence of giant cell arteritis-related stroke and rheumatoid arthritis.MethodsA case report and discussion.ResultsA 73 year-old man with seronegative elderly-onset rheumatoid arthritis (EORA) presented to the emergency department (ED) with a one week history of frontal headache, vomiting and dizziness. He had multiple cardiovascular comorbidities and took multiple medications, including methotrexate and sulfasalazine. He also had long-standing history of thrombocytopenia without requiring any treatment. Neurological examination performed in the ED was unremarkable. His C-reactive protein (CRP) was 69mg/L and erythrocyte sedimentation rate (ESR) 82mm/hour. Computed tomography (CT) of the brain was normal. The headache settled with analgesia. A diagnosis of probable tension-type headache, with underlying active EORA, was made.One month later, he presented to an ophthalmologist with recurrence of headache associated with visual disturbance and was diagnosed with giant cell arteritis (GCA). Both CRP (77mg/L) and ESR (85mm/hour) remained raised. Neither temporal artery biopsy nor temporal artery ultrasound were possible due to the coronavirus disease 2019 (COVID-19) pandemic. The headache and visual symptoms resolved completely a week after prednisolone 60mg daily was prescribed. In parallel, the CRP dropped to 2mg/L and ESR 16mm/hour. The patient’s glucocorticoid dose was then tapered. While on prednisolone 20mg daily, about 3 weeks later, he developed slurred speech and generalized weakness. Examination showed cerebellar signs and MRI brain showed acute cerebellar infarct. He was treated pragmatically as an atherosclerotic stroke with clopidogrel, and the steroid was rapidly tapered in view of absence of headache and normalization of inflammatory markers.Four weeks later, he was noted to have persistent confusion and unsteadiness of gait. CRP was elevated at 92mg/L. An urgent positron emission tomography-CT (PET-CT) scan showed inflammation in the vertebral arteries [Figure 1] and cerebellar stroke. Prednisolone 40mg daily was restarted which led to a rapid improvement in his symptoms and normalization of inflammatory markers. The glucocorticoids were tapered in a slower manner this time.Figure 1.Fused axial image of a PET-CT scan demonstrating increased uptake in the region of the left vertebral artery within the vertebral foramen.A diagnosis of GCA-related cerebellar stroke with vertebral vasculitis was made and, with glucocorticoids, the patient made a good clinical recovery. His inflammatory joints pain also improved in parallel.ConclusionStroke or transient ischemic stroke are rare complications, reported in 2.8-16% of patients with active GCA. Most studies report strokes as occurring between the onset of GCA symptoms and 4 weeks after commencement of glucocorticoids1-3.Vertebrobasilar territory is involved in 60–88% of cases of GCA-related stroke1-3. In contrast, the vertebrobasilar territory is affected only in 15-20% of atherosclerotic strokes1,2. Abstract
IMPORTANCE Brain metastasis (BM) is the most common malignant intracranial neoplasm in adults with over 100,000 new cases annually in the United States and outnumbering primary brain tumors 10:1. OBSERVATIONS The incidence of BM in adult cancer patients ranges from 10-40%, and is increasing with improved surveillance, effective systemic therapy, and an aging population. The overall prognosis of cancer patients is largely dependent on the presence or absence of brain metastasis, and therefore, a timely and accurate diagnosis is crucial for improving long-term outcomes, especially in the current era of significantly improved systemic therapy for many common cancers. BM should be suspected in any cancer patient who develops new neurological deficits or behavioral abnormalities. Gadolinium enhanced MRI is the preferred imaging technique and BM must be distinguished from other pathologies. Large, symptomatic lesion(s) in patients with good functional status are best treated with surgery and stereotactic radiosurgery (SRS). Due to neurocognitive side effects and improved overall survival of cancer patients, whole brain radiotherapy (WBRT) is reserved as salvage therapy for patients with multiple lesions or as palliation. Newer approaches including multi-lesion stereotactic surgery, targeted therapy, and immunotherapy are also being investigated to improve outcomes while preserving quality of life. CONCLUSION With the significant advancements in the systemic treatment for cancer patients, addressing BM effectively is critical for overall survival. In addition to patient's performance status, therapeutic approach should be based on the type of primary tumor and associated molecular profile as well as the size, number, and location of metastatic lesion(s).

Abstract
Background:The number of immune-modulatory drugs used to treat immune-mediated inflammatory diseases (IMIDs) has exponentially increased in recent decades. While effective in controlling disease, serious infection remains a concern.Accurate information on immune-modulatory drugs, including infections, is required to guide prescribing decisions. The “summary of product characteristics” (SmPC) by the European Medicines Agency (EMA) provides a useful repository of information on adverse events e.g. infections, from clinical trials and post-marketing pharmacovigilance (1).To date, no comparison has been undertaken on reported infection frequencies across SmPCs for immune-modulators.Objectives:To compare infection frequency, site and type across the most commonly-prescribed immune-modulatory drugs used to treat IMIDs, using information provided by SmPCs.Methods:A drug was included if licensed in Europe for treatment of one of the following: rheumatoid arthritis, axial spondyloarthritis, connective tissue disease, autoimmune vasculitis, autoinflammatory syndromes, inflammatory bowel disease (Crohn’s and ulcerative colitis), psoriasis, multiple sclerosis and other rarer conditions.The Electronic Medicines Compendium (EMC) was searched for commonly prescribed immune-modulatory drugs used for the above indications. SmPC documents were manually searched for information on infection frequency, extracted from sections 4.4 and 4.8. Infection frequency was recorded as per convention in the SmPC: very common (≥1/10); common (≥1/100 to <1/10); uncommon (≥1/1,000 to <1/100); rare (≥1/10,000 to <1/1,000); very rare (<1/10,000) (1), for each drug. Information was further extracted on infection site (e.g. respiratory, skin etc), type (e.g. bacterial, viral etc) and individual pathogenic organisms.25% of included SmPCs were screened and extracted by a second reviewer. Disagreements were resolved with input from a third reviewer.Results:In total, 39 drugs were included, used across 20 indications: nine conventional synthetic disease-modifying anti-rheumatic drugs (csDMARDs), six targeted synthetic DMARDs (tsDMARDs; four Janus kinase [JAK] inhibitors, two sphingosine 1-phosphate receptor modulators) and 24 biologic DMARDs (17 cytokine-targeted; seven cell-targeted).Twelve sites of infection were recorded. Minimal or no site information was available for most csDMARDs and siponimod, certolizumab pegol and rituximab. The most common sites of infection are listed by drug group in Figure 1. Upper respiratory tract was the most common site, especially with bDMARDs. Lower respiratory, ear/nose/throat (including sinusitis) and urinary tract infections were moderately common, with clustering within drug groups. No drugs reported risk of cardiac infections; the eye, musculoskeletal, neurological, oral and reproductive sites were the least commonly-reported sites of infection.Infection data for 27 distinct pathogens were recorded, the majority viruses, especially with bDMARD use. Herpes simplex and zoster were the most frequently listed (mainly with bDMARDs and tsDMARDs), followed by influenza. Common non-viral causes of infection were candida and tinea species.Variable or absent reporting was noted for opportunistic infections (e.g. tuberculosis and fungi) and certain high-prevalence viruses e.g. Epstein-Barr.Conclusion:The SmPC literature reports differences in infection risk, by site and pathogen, between immune-modulatory drugs. The findings can be used to visualise differences and aid treatment decisions. However, some of the patterns we have shown lack face-validity to clinicians familiar with real-world safety data. Abstract
Background:Fragility fractures (FF) can occur at various sites of the skeleton, and are associated with multiple risk factors [1]. The prevalence of FF markedly increases with age. As the longevity of the population increases, so will the incidence of FF, and that of associated co-morbidities and risk factors. There are few data on co-morbidities associated with fractures at each site.Objectives:Identify associations of co-morbidities with sites of FF, by applying cluster analysis.Methods:We reviewed 28868 patients presenting for BMD estimation at a district general hospital in North West England, 2004-2016. We identified patients who had sustained one or more FF at time of presentation. Site(s) of FF were recorded for each patient, including femur, forearm, humerus, pelvis, ribs, spine, tibia or fibula. The following co-morbidities or treatments were recorded: excess alcohol consumption (previous or current); bisphosphonates; coeliac disease; family history of FF; hormone replacement therapy; hyperparathyroidism; hyperthyroidism; inflammatory bowel disease; polymyalgia rheumatica; rheumatoid arthritis; smoking (previous or current); corticosteroids (previous or current). Cluster analysis was performed on fracture sites and co-morbidities, using Jaccard similarity coefficient, and plotted on a dendrogram. Results were divided into an optimal number of clusters, derived using the elbow and silhouette methods.Results:11003 of 28868 patients had sustained one or more FF at time of BMD estimation. Overall, 84.6% patients were female, mean age 67.5years, and median T-score -1.12 SD. Cluster analysis was performed for FF sites and co-morbidities, with Jaccard similarity coefficients calculated. 4 clusters were identified (Figure 1): FF of forearm (n=5054), tibia/fibula (n=2617), spine (n=2352), associated with family history of FF, smoking, corticosteroids, and bisphosphonate treatment; FF of pelvis (n=300) associated with hyperparathyroidism, PMR, coeliac disease, and HRT; FF of femur (n=1181) and humerus (n=1131) associated with IBD and RA; FF of ribs (n=1022) associated with alcohol and hyperthyroidism.Conclusion:Cluster analysis demonstrated 4 distinct subgroups of FF sites and associated co-morbidities. To our knowledge, this is the first study applying cluster analysis to evaluate co-morbidities associated with FF sites. Risk factors may influence trabecular more than cortical bone, accounting for the difference in clusters. Abstract
Background:Fragility fractures (FF) are those resulting from mechanical forces equivalent to a fall from standing height or less [1]. They most commonly occur in the spine (vertebrae), forearm, and femur, but also occur at other sites. Prevalence markedly increases with age, due to age-related and menopause-related bone loss. FF cause substantial pain and disability, and are associated with decreased life expectancy. While many studies have investigated risk factors associated with FF, there are few data on the association between FF sites in at-risk patients.Objectives:1. Establish the most common sites of FF in patients presenting for bone mineral density (BMD) estimation.2. Identify patterns of co-existing FF in the above cohort by applying cluster analysis.Methods:We retrospectively reviewed the clinical records of 28868 patients presenting for BMD estimation at a district general hospital in North West England, 2004-2016, identifying those who had sustained one or more FF. Site(s) of FF were recorded for each patient, categorised as: ankle, elbow, femur, forearm, humerus, pelvis, ribs, spine, tibia or fibula (recorded as “tibfib”). Cluster analysis was performed on fracture sites, using Jaccard similarity coefficient. Results were plotted on a dendrogram and divided into clusters, as per results derived from elbow and silhouette cluster methods.Results:Out of 28868 patients presenting for BMD estimation, 11003 were identified as having sustained one or more FF. 84.6% patients were female, with overall mean age 67.5years and median T-score -1.12 SD. The most common site of FF was the forearm (n=5045), most commonly co-existing with fractures of the tibia or fibula. Frequencies of the most common and co-existing FF sites are shown in Figure 1 (top). Cluster analysis identified 3 clusters: ankle and elbow; forearm, tibia/fibula, ribs, and spine; pelvis, femur, and humerus. The second half of Figure 1 displays the dendrogram of cluster analysis results, with Jaccard similarity measure.Conclusion:We applied cluster analysis to a large cohort of patients presenting for BMD estimation. Our results are in keeping with previous studies demonstrating the FF to most commonly occur in the forearm, and in those with osteopenia (T-score -2.5 < -1 SD) [2]. To our knowledge, this is the first study to apply cluster analysis to sites of FF. Abstract
Background:The acute hot joint presentation is a common clinical emergency, often the result of crystal arthritis or trauma. However, all diagnoses can mimic septic arthritis, which should be excluded promptly due to the potential for rapid joint destruction and significant morbidity. The gold-standard test for septic arthritis is synovial fluid culture, which can take several days to perform. Meanwhile, patients are often admitted and given antimicrobials. Other specialties have made use of rapid biomarkers to exclude infection, for example, exclusion of empyema using pleural fluid pH and glucose [1]. Such biomarkers could reduce the need for lengthy hospital admissions and inappropriate antibiotic use in the acute hot joint presentation.Objectives:1.Evaluate research interest over time, on the use of diagnostic biomarkers in the acute hot joint presentation.2.Compare research interest in the use of diagnostic biomarkers in acute hot native versus acute hot prosthetic joints.Methods:We performed a review of the number of publications reporting the use and diagnostic accuracy of biomarkers to exclude infection in the acute hot joint presentations. The database,Scopus, was searched for English-language studies (1946-2018) using search terms relating to septic arthritis, crystal arthritis, and diagnostic markers derived from synovial fluid/aspirate. The number of papers published per year on prosthetic joints only was also calculated. Therefore, the following were recorded for each year 1946-2018: total number of studies; prosthetic joints only; native joints only. Values were plotted, with polynomial trend-lines and R2calculated.Results:Our search yielded 2279 relevant studies in total (561 on prosthetic joints), published 1946-2018. Only 1 study was identified for the year 1946; the next recorded publication was in 1960. Therefore, this single study was excluded as an outlier. Results are presented in Figure 1. The number of studies on diagnostic biomarkers for acute hot joints continued to increase after 1960. From 2016, the number of studies conducted in prosthetic joints outnumbered those done in native joints. Polynomial trend-lines applied to the results showed studies on native acute hot joints are predicted to decline, while those in prosthetic joints will continue to increase.Conclusion:Reasons for an increasing number of studies on prosthetic compared to native acute hot joints include a narrower differential diagnosis in prosthetic joints, i.e. septic vs aseptic. In contrast, native acute hot joints may be the result of various causes including crystal arthritis, inflammatory arthritis, and trauma. Having a narrower differential diagnosis may facilitate diagnostic research in prosthetic joint presentations. Furthermore, incidence of prosthetic joint infection is also greater than that of native joint infection [2]. Nonetheless, the incidence of native joint infection is increasing [3]. Abstract
AbstractPersonality and its potential role in mediating risk of psychiatric disorders and suicidality are assessed by sexual orientation, using data collected among young Swiss men (n = 5875) recruited while presenting for mandatory military conscription. Mental health outcomes were analyzed by sexual attraction using logistic regression, controlling for five-factor model personality traits and socio-demographics. Homo/bisexual men demonstrated the highest scores for neuroticism-anxiety but the lowest for sociability and sensation seeking, with no differences for aggression-hostility. Among homo/bisexual men, 10.2% fulfilled diagnostic criteria for major depression in the past 2 weeks, 10.8% for ADHD in the past 12 months, 13.8% for lifetime anti-social personality disorder (ASPD), and 6.0% attempted suicide in the past 12 months. Upon adjusting (AOR) for personality traits, their odds ratios (OR) for major depression (OR = 4.78, 95% CI 2.81–8.14; AOR = 1.46, 95% CI 0.80–2.65) and ADHD (OR = 2.17, 95% CI = 1.31–3.58; AOR = 1.00, 95% CI 0.58–1.75) lost statistical significance, and the odds ratio for suicide attempt was halved (OR = 5.10, 95% CI 2.57–10.1; AOR = 2.42, 95% CI 1.16–5.02). There are noteworthy differences in personality traits by sexual orientation, and much of the increased mental morbidity appears to be accounted for by such underlying differences, with important implications for etiology and treatment.

Abstract
AIMS To examine the quality of life (QOL) of parents of children with a specific mental disorder (any age). METHODS Relevant articles were searched using different databases. Articles were included that compared the QOL of parents with mentally-ill children to parents of healthy controls or norm values or provided the required data for this comparison. A meta-analysis was conducted to obtain an overall mean effect size estimate. Additional analyses were performed to assess publication bias and moderation. RESULTS Twenty-six out of 10 548 articles met the pre-defined inclusion criteria. Most of these studies focused on attention-deficit/hyperactivity disorder or autism spectrum disorder, used clinical samples that mainly included males and young children and studied the QOL of mothers. The meta-analysis revealed that parents of mentally-ill children are experiencing a clinically relevant reduction in their QOL relative to parents of healthy children and norm values (g = -0.66). CONCLUSIONS The compromised QOL of parents of mentally-ill children needs to be considered and addressed by health professionals who are in contact with them. The paper provides insights into existing research gaps and suggests improvements for subsequent work.

Abstract
Objectives Bone loss in systemic lupus erythematosus is multifactorial. Recent studies demonstrate corticosteroids, previous fractures and increasing age decrease bone mineral density. The effect of body mass index and fat mass are less well characterized. We sought to determine fracture risk factors in patients undergoing dual-energy X-ray absorptiometry scanning at a district hospital in 2004-2015. Methods Standard dual-energy X-ray absorptiometry parameters were recorded, plus rheumatoid arthritis diagnosis, smoking status, alcohol consumption, family history of fractures, history of secondary operation and corticosteroid use. Data were analyzed using Fisher's exact test for categorical data and logistic regression for continuous data. Results One hundred and fifty patients (141 women, nine men) with SLE were included; 52 (34.6%) had sustained at least one fracture. Fracture risk increased with increased age, body mass index, fat mass and average tissue thickness, and decreased lean mass (adjusted for steroid use), as well as with smoking and rheumatoid arthritis. Increased femoral and vertebral bone mineral density conversely decreased fracture risk. Conclusion Our study suggests increased age, body mass index, fat mass, smoking and/or rheumatoid arthritis increase fracture risk in SLE patients. To our knowledge, this is the first demonstration of a correlation between increased fat mass, adjusted for steroid use and fracture risk, in adults, potentially indicating a differential effect of fat on bone metabolism and lessening of lean body mass.

Abstract
Transplant recipients are vulnerable to a horde of infections and neoplastic conditions due to immunosuppression. Posttransplant lymphoproliferative disorder (PTLD) is a condition unique to the transplant recipient occurring due to monoclonal lymphocytic proliferation. It may affect any organ system with reportedly highest incidence in the gastrointestinal tract. The incidence of adenocarcinoma of the colon, however, has not been shown to be uniformly higher in transplant recipients. We report here an unusual case of adenocarcinoma of the ascending colon presenting with liver, lymph node and skin metastasis in a transplant recipient, which simulated PTLD both clinically and radiologically. For any gastrointestinal lesion in transplant recipient, the possibility of carcinoma must be considered. However, a high index of suspicion for PTLD facilitates early diagnosis since the treatment of the two conditions is starkly different.

Abstract
Glioblastoma multiforme patients have a poor prognosis due to therapeutic resistance and tumor relapse. It has been suggested that gliomas are driven by a rare subset of tumor cells known as glioma stem cells (GSCs). This hypothesis states that only a few GSCs are able to divide, differentiate, and initiate a new tumor. It has also been shown that this subpopulation is more resistant to conventional therapies than its differentiated counterpart. In order to understand glioma recurrence post therapy, we investigated the behavior of GSCs after primary chemotherapy. We first show that exposure of patient-derived as well as established glioma cell lines to therapeutic doses of temozolomide (TMZ), the most commonly used antiglioma chemotherapy, consistently increases the GSC pool over time both in vitro and in vivo. Secondly, lineage-tracing analysis of the expanded GSC pool suggests that such amplification is a result of a phenotypic shift in the non-GSC population to a GSC-like state in the presence of TMZ. The newly converted GSC population expresses markers associated with pluripotency and stemness, such as CD133, SOX2, Oct4, and Nestin. Furthermore, we show that intracranial implantation of the newly converted GSCs in nude mice results in a more efficient grafting and invasive phenotype. Taken together, these findings provide the first evidence that glioma cells exposed to chemotherapeutic agents are able to interconvert between non-GSCs and GSCs, thereby replenishing the original tumor population, leading to a more infiltrative phenotype and enhanced chemoresistance. This may represent a potential mechanism for therapeutic relapse.

Abstract
AIM To study accommodation in relation to different refractive errors, amblyopia and to measure the anatomical changes in the accommodating eye MATERIALS AND METHODS We studied the amplitude of accommodation (AA) in 150 patients in the age group 11 ± 30 years which included emmetropes, myopes, hypermetropes and hypermetropic amblyopes using the Royal Air Force (RAF) rule. The anterior chamber depth (ACD), axial length (AxL) and lens thickness (LT) changes during accommodation were measured using an A-scan. Myopes and hypermetropes were further divided based on the amount of refractive error : less than 2D, 2 -4D and greater than 4D. RESULTS Corrected low myopes had the highest accommodation amplitude (p less than 0.05) followed by emmetropes. Corrected hypermetropes were found to have the lowest amplitude of accommodation (p less than 0.05). The amblyopic eye had a significantly low AA compared to the non-amblyopic eye (p less than 0.05). ACD decreased (p less than 0.05) and LT increased (p less than 0.05) during accommodation. The AxL increase was maximum in myopes (p less than 0.05) followed by hypermetropes but the change was not significant in hypermetropes (p greater than 0.05). CONCLUSION The amblyopic eye has low amplitudes of accommodation proving the benefit of near adds in amblyopic patients. Prolonged near work might induce myopia in susceptible eyes by increasing the axial length.

Abstract
AIM To study the various ocular anatomical and physiological parameters in presbyopia. MATERIALS AND METHODS We studied the various ocular anatomical and physiological parameters like corneal curvature (keratometry readings: K1 and K2), central corneal thickness (CCT), anterior chamber depth (ACD), lens thickness (LT) and axial length (AL) in 100 presbyopic patients between 35 - 55 years of age. The patients were divided into two age groups: I (35 ± 44 years) and II (45-55 yrs). ACD, AL and LT were measured using an Ascan. CCT was measured with ultrasonic pachymetry. RESULTS The CCT decreased (BE), LT increased and ACD decreased (RE) significantly with increasing age (p less than 0.05). There was no significant difference in males and females. Nearly 3/4th of the total increase in lens thickness was responsible for the decrease in the anterior chamber depth and the rest, 1/4th , goes posteriorly. Corneal curvature and AL showed no significant change with age. CONCLUSIONS The mean of CCT decreased significantly with advancing age. As age increased, the mean value of lens thickness increased and anterior chamber depth decreased. Nearly 3/4th of total increase in LT was anteriorly, decreasing the ACD. Corneal curvature and AL has no relation with age.

Abstract
In the present study, the effects of orally-administered lithium on testicular morphology were examined in the spotted munia (Lonchura punctulata), a seasonally breeding sub-tropical finch. Adult males were procured from natural populations during the month of August, a time when these birds begin to show seasonal reproductive maturity in an annual cycle. Both during the period of acclimation, and throughout the subsequent experimental period, the birds were maintained in an open aviary simulating natural environmental conditions. Lithium was dissolved in distilled water and was administered via the oral route by means of a commercially available stomach-tube. A total of five experimental groups were utilized. The first group (Group A) served as control and received lithium-free distilled water in a similar manner. In the remaining four groups, lithium was administered daily as follows: Group B (2.5 mEq/Kg body weight for 5 days); Group C (2.5 mEq/Kg for 10 days); Group D (5.0 mEq/Kg for 5 days) and Group E (5.0 mEq/Kg for 10 days). All lithium administrations were carried out between 14:00 and 15:00h. Twenty-four hours after the last oral lithium, final body weights were recorded, blood samples were obtained (by brachial vein puncture for the measurement of serum lithium) and the animals were sacrificed, and testes were collected for histological studies. Our results indicated that lithium treatment led to a significant reduction in testicular weight and seminiferous tubular diameter, and a marked degenerative changes in germ cells in that most of the spermatids and mature spermatozoa showed necrotic changes and were sloughed off from the seminiferous tubular epithelium. Complete desquamation and loss of germ cells, and their clump formation were also noted within many seminiferous tubular lumen. Notably these adverse effects were observed when serum lithium levels were within the therapeutic range for human. These results confirm our earlier report on lithium's adverse effects on testicular function, and extend further to show that lithium indeed has a significant adverse effect on the histomorphology, and, thus, the function of the testis in birds.

Abstract
An Escherichia coli O157:H7 strain isolated from a patient with hemorrhagic colitis was found to exhibit two slightly different colony morphology types on differential medium. Each morphological type, designated TT12A and TT12B, was isolated, and serological testing using various assays confirmed that both strains carried the O157 and the H7 antigens. Biochemical testing showed that the strains had identical profiles on AP120E analysis and, like typical O157:H7 strains, did not ferment sorbitol or exhibit beta-glucuronidase activity. Analysis with a multiplex PCR assay showed that TT12B did not carry the gene for either Shiga toxin 1 (Stx1) or Stx2, whereas these genes were present in TT12A and the toxins were produced. Apart from that, both strains carried the +93 gusA mutation, the cluster I ehxA gene for enterohemolysin, and the eae gene for gamma-intimin, which are all characteristics of the O157:H7 serotype. Phenotypic assays confirmed that both strains exhibited enterohemolysin activity and the attachment and effacing lesion on HeLa cells. Multilocus enzyme electrophoresis analysis showed that the strains are closely related genetically and belong in the same clonal group. Pulsed-field gel electrophoresis (PFGE) typing of XbaI-digested genomic DNA revealed that the two strains differed by two bands but shared 90% similarity and clustered in the same clade. All other non-Stx-producing O157:H7 strains examined clustered in a major clade that was distinct from that of Stx-producing O157:H7 strains. The findings that TT12B was identical to TT12A, except for Stx production, and its PFGE profile is also more closely related to that of Stx-producing O157:H7 strains suggest that TT12B was derived from TT12A by the loss of both stx genes.

Abstract
Effects of daily evening (just before the onset of darkness in a 24 h light dark cycle) administration of graded doses (25, 50, or 100 microg/100 g body wt./day for 30 days) of melatonin on the concentrations of blood glucose and adrenal catecholamines were studied in sexually active male roseringed parakeets under natural (NP; approximately 12L: 12D) and artificial long (LP; 16L: 8D) and short (SP; 8L: 16D) photoperiods. Blood samples and adrenal glands were collected from each bird during the mid-day on the following day of the last treatment. The concentrations of glucose in blood and epinephrine (E) and norepinephrine (NE) in the adrenals were measured. The results of the study indicated that exogenous melatonin induces hypo- or hyperglycemia depending on the dose of hormone administered as well as to the length of photoperiod to which birds were exposed. The levels of E and NE in the adrenals were shown also to vary in relation to photoperiod and the dose of melatonin administered. But the nature of the influence of melatonin becomes different under altered photoperiodic conditions. It appears that short photoperiods are more effective than long photoperiods as a modulator of glycemic and adrenal catecholaminergic responses to exogenous melatonin. A statistically significant correlation between the levels of blood glucose and that of E and NE in the adrenals was found in the control birds, but not in the melatonin treated birds. The results suggested that the responses of blood glucose and adrenal catecholamines to the treatment with melatonin in the roseringed parakeets may not be dependent on each other.

Abstract
Effects of daily (one hour prior to onset of darkness) injection of melatonin (25 micrograms/100 g body wt. for 30 days) on concentrations of blood glucose and adrenal catecholamines were studied in adult male roseringed parakeets, P. krameri under both natural (NP; about 12L:12D) and artificial long (LP; 16L:8D; lights were available in between 0600 and 2200 hrs) or short (SP; 8L:16D; lights were available between 0600 and 1400 hrs) photoperiodic conditions. The results indicate that neither LP, nor SP as such exerts any significant effect on blood glucose titre of control (vehicle of hormone administered) birds. Treatment with melatonin, however, induced hyperglycemia in both NP and LP bird groups, but hypoglycemia in SP birds. Unlike glycemic levels, amount of epinephrine (E) and norepinephrine (NE) in adrenals of control birds exhibited significant changes under altered photoperiods. A decrease in E and an increase in NE were noted in adrenals of both LP and SP birds. Exogenous melatonin in NP birds also caused a decrease in E and concomittant rise in NE levels. On the other hand, treatment of melatonin in both LP and SP bird groups resulted in an increase in the quantity of both E and NE compared to respective values in adrenals of melatonin injected NP birds. However, relative to the amount of E and NE in adrenals of placebo treated LP and SP birds, significant effect of melatonin treatment was observed only in SP birds. The results suggest that influences of exogenous melatonin on the levels of both blood glucose and adrenal catecholamines are largely modulated by short rather than long photoperiods.

Abstract
Recent advances have added substantially to our understanding of the biology of estrogens. Estrogens are no longer considered to differ only in potency. Two estrogens can have similar effects in one tissue and very different effects in another. Additionally, an estrogen can have different effects in different tissues. It is now recognized that there are at least two estrogen receptors, ER-alpha and ER-beta, and that it is quite likely that estrogens also work through non-genomic mechanisms. The development of new methods of chromatographic separation has aided substantially in our ability to characterize the composition of Premarin, including the identification of estradiene, the fourth-most abundant estrogen in Premarin. Recent studies have contributed to our understanding of the unique profile of Delta(8,9) dehydroestrone sulfate, another of the Premarin estrogens. It was found that Delta(8,9) dehydroestrone sulfate is an active estrogen with a distinct pharmacological profile that results in significant clinical activity in vasomotor, neuroendocrine and bone preservation parameters. However, it displayed little or no efficacy, at the dose studied, on other peripheral parameters normally affected by classical estrogens. Increasing knowledge of the unique profiles of the Premarin components, as well as their complex interaction, will help to increase our understanding of the clinical profile of Premarin.

Abstract
The discovery of kilohertz quasi-periodic oscillations (kHz QPOs) in low-mass X-ray binaries (LMXBs) with the Rossi X-Ray Timing Explorer has stimulated extensive studies of these sources. Recently, Osherovich & Titarchuk suggested a new model for kHz QPOs and the related correlations between kHz QPOs and low-frequency features in LMXBs. Here we use their results to study the mass-radius relation for the atoll source 4U 1728-34. We find that, if this model is correct, 4U 1728-34 is possibly a strange star rather than a neutron star.

Abstract
Recent basic and clinical advances have consolidated the concept of tissue-selective estrogens, i.e. molecules that express different degrees of partial agonist, full agonist or antagonist activity in different tissues or cells. Delta8,9-Dehydroestrone sulfate (delta8,9-DHES) is a conjugated estrogen and a component of conjugated equine estrogens (CEE). It is metabolized in the human in at least a 1:1 ratio to its 17beta form, 17beta-delta8,9-DHES. To evaluate its activity in different clinical and biochemical parameters, a clinical research study was conducted with delta8,9-DHES and estrone sulfate as a comparator in postmenopausal women. Delta8,9-DHES was given orally at a daily dose of 0.125 mg for 12 weeks in a group of 10 women. Two additional groups of women received either estrone sulfate alone (1.25 mg/day) or the combination of delta8,9-DHES and estrone sulfate at the previously specified doses. A significant and consistent suppression of hot flushes (number, severity, and total score) was observed with delta8,9-DHES, reaching more than 95% suppression in all parameters of vasomotor symptoms. This level of activity was equal to that obtained with the much higher dose of estrone sulfate, and it was sustained for the duration of the treatment period (12 weeks). Measurements of a bone resorption marker, i.e. urinary excretion of N-telopeptide, demonstrated that delta8,9-DHES at 8 weeks produced a degree of suppression (40%) similar to that observed with the higher dose of estrone sulfate. Gonadotropin secretion (FSH and LH) was significantly suppressed in women receiving delta8,9-DHES, similar to that observed with estrone sulfate alone or with the combination of the two. Other parameters, such as total cholesterol, low density lipoprotein cholesterol and high density lipoprotein cholesterol were not modified significantly, whereas serum globulins (sex hormone-binding globulin and corticosteroid-binding globulin) showed only marginal increases after delta8,9-DHES administration. Taken together with preclinical data, it is found that delta8,9-DHES is an active estrogen with a distinct pharmacological profile that results in significant clinical activity in vasomotor, neuroendocrine (gonadotropin and PRL) and bone preservation parameters, whereas displaying little or no efficacy, at the dose tested, on other peripheral parameters normally affected by estrogens. Collectively, this information supports the concept that delta8,9-DHES is an integral component of CEE, with distinct tissue selectivity contributing to the CEE's overall clinical activity, and places this estrogen as a distinct member of a novel class of centrally active molecules with unique peripheral tissue selectivity.

Abstract
A large proportion of the beneficial effects that oestrogens demonstrate on the vasculature are believed to be mediated via direct effects on the vascular wall. In this study we compared a number of oestrogenic compounds isolated from pregnant mare's urine including 17beta-oestradiol and oestrone, in terms of their abilities to inhibit stimulated endothelin-1 release from normal human coronary artery endothelial cells (CAEC). We also examined their ability to stimulate expression of constitutive endothelial nitric oxide synthase (eNOS) and explored their effects on cellular angiotensin converting enzyme (ACE). All the oestrogens tested were able to inhibit serum-stimulated ET-1 release. Oestrone and 17alpha-dihydroequilenin failed to significantly affect cellular eNOS levels. 17Beta-oestradiol and oestrone significantly increased cellular ACE levels while 17beta,delta(8,9)-dehydroestradiol decreased cellular ACE. We discuss these observations in terms of their potential clinical relevance and use as a means of screening novel oestrogen-like compounds.

Abstract
In the present study, we tested the hypothesis that the neuropeptides, vasoactive intestinal peptide (VIP) and neuropeptide Y (NPY), which are present in the thyroid nerves, act as physiological neurotransmitters involved in the regulation of thyroid hormone secretion and thyroid blood flow. Specifically, we examined whether these neuropeptides can be released into thyroid blood vessels by electrical stimulation of the major thyroid nerves or whether their expression is altered by changes in iodine intake. Sprague-Dawley rats were used in this study. The cervical sympathetic trunk or the superior laryngeal nerve was stimulated by bipolar electrodes in anesthetized rats. During nerve stimulation, blood samples were withdrawn from the thyroid vein. Thyroid blood flow was monitored by laser Doppler blood flowmetry. Sympathetic stimulation caused a marked decrease in thyroid blood flow, which was associated with a significant increase in release of norepinephrine. However, these effects were not accompanied by any change in NPY release into the thyroid vein. Stimulation of the superior laryngeal nerve was not associated with changes in thyroid blood flow or VIP release into the thyroid vein. In a separate experiment, rats were fed a diet containing low-, high-, or normal iodine concentrations. Triiodothyronine (T3) and thyroxine (T4) levels in thyroid venous plasma were significantly reduced in rats fed a low-iodine diet but not in a separate group of rats fed a high iodine diet. However, these treatments had no effect on VIP or NPY concentrations in thyroid venous plasma or in thyroid ganglia. Thus, our results indicate that VIP and NPY, which are present in the thyroid nerves, may not be directly involved in the regulation of thyroid function.

Abstract
Purified bovine milk proteins that were added to cultures of murine spleen cells significantly increased cell proliferation and production of immunoglobulin M. Casein and a whey mixture consisting of alpha-lactalbumin, bovine serum albumin, bovine gamma globulin, and beta-lactoglobulin (beta-LG) were stimulatory. Of the three beta-LG preparations that are commercially available (beta-LG containing variants A and B, purified variant A, and purified variant B), the unseparated mixture containing both the A and B variants showed the most immunomodulatory activity. Both alkaline treatment and trypsin digestion of the beta-LG preparation markedly reduced its effectiveness. Polymyxin B, while greatly diminishing the stimulatory effect of lipopolysaccharide, had no significant effect on either the enhancement of cell proliferation or the enhancement of immunoglobulin production by beta-LG. In the presence of S-(n-butyl)-homocysteine sulfoxamine, the stimulatory effect of beta-LG on cell proliferation and IgM production in vitro was markedly reduced.

Abstract
The testes in different groups of whitethroated munia (Lonchura malabarica) were studied following exogenous treatment of testosterone propionate (1 mg/100 g body wt./day) at 06.00 h or 14.00 h or 22.00 h for 15 consecutive days during the quiescent phase of the annual testicular cycle. The testicular conditions in each group of testosterone treated and appropriate control (administered only with the vehicle of hormone at corresponding time-points) group of birds were analyzed by the studies of paired testicular weight, seminiferous tubular diameter, spermatogenetic index, and cytology of the testicular germ cells. The results of the study revealed that exogenous testosterone was stimulatory to the testicular functions irrespective of the time of treatment. The gametokinetic response of the testes to exogenous testosterone also did not show any statistical difference among the birds treated at different hours of the day. The present study demonstrates for the first time that the responses of the testes to exogenous testosterone during the post-breeding phase in an annual testicular cycle of a wild bird does not vary with the time of administration.

Abstract
A new decelerating technique that places dc potentials on the orthogonal excitation and receiver plates as well as the rear trapping plate (conductance limit) of the source cell of a dual cubic cell has been applied to the standard matrix-assisted laser desorption/ionization Fourier transform mass spectrometry technique. When this five-plate trapping method is applied, high-mass ions with large translational kinetic energies can be trapped efficiently and detected. Using this approach, low-resolution spectra of carbonic anhydrase (MW = 29,000), egg albumin (MW = 45,000), and bovine albumin (MW = 66,000) have been obtained. Because the new decelerating method requires no modification to the existing cell, it is also possible to obtain high-resolution spectra for compounds with masses of ca. 14,000 Da and lower. Utilizing the five-plate trapping method, a bovine insulin spectrum with a resolving power of 20,000 was obtained. It is not yet possible to obtain higher resolution for the higher mass proteins. The reasons for this difficulty are currently being investigated.
